CIM Distinguished Service Medal - Winner 1999

John E. Udd, FCIM John E. Udd, FCIM
Ottawa, ON

"In recognition of his long and meritorious service to CIM, its membership, and the development of research for the benefit of the Canadian mining industry."




John Eaman Udd, a mining engineer, received his Bachelor's, Master's and Doctorate degrees from McGill University, and subsequently became Director of the Mining Engineering Program and founding Director of the University's Office of Colleges and Schools Liaison. He then joined Falconbridge Nickel Mines, before being appointed Director of the Mining Research Laboratories of the federal government (1984-1996). He is presently Principal Scientist Mining.

Dr. Udd has written extensively and is the author or co-author of over 100 technical papers which have been published around the world. Many of these concern aspects of his particular expertise, which is rock mechanics and ground control (mine stability). Many others, however, are on more general topics relating to mining education and mining history.
